What Should Be Included in a School Report Card

A good report card should give a complete picture of a student’s performance, not just scores.

1. Student Information

  • Name
  • Class
  • Term
  • Academic year

2. Subject Scores

Each subject should show:

  • Classwork score
  • Exam score
  • Total score

3. Grades

Use simple grading like:

  • Excellent
  • Very Good
  • Good
  • Needs Improvement

4. Competence Levels

This shows how well the student understands:

  • Advanced
  • Proficient
  • Developing
  • Beginning

5. Position in Class

This helps show how the student compares with others.

6. Attendance

Include:

  • Days present
  • Days absent

7. Teacher’s Remarks

Short comments about performance and behavior.

8. Headteacher’s Remark

A final comment from the school.

Keep It Simple

A report card should be easy to read and understand.
